So I've read through this thread & others. My car had a 1st and 2nd gear along with synchos replaced by the dealer after I gave up 4 teeth, 10 cases of Coors light and agreed to say the transmission shifts like a hot knife through butter. Still shifts bad into 1st and grinds and locks out and whines like I have a roots blower and makes me want to remove it to make it serve its real purpose; boat anchor. My car is 99% daily driven and I don't beat on it. I see many agree the clutch, throwout, helper spring, etc are the cause of the garbage performance of these boxes. I also see many that change all these components still have lockout, grinding and all the other good stuff. Isn't the core issue the transmission? Had an '03 Cobra with T56 that I drove hard and never had any issues like this other than wearing out the clutch due to drag racing use. I'm thinking when the time comes a Tremec conversion will be the answer. Any one done this?

I'm the latest addition to this problem. 800 mi on the car, and under hard shifting (drag racing) I'm getting locked-out 2-3. When this happens I can't get it into 1st, or 5th either. I added the Whiteline Tranny mount stiffener, and if anything, it has made things worse. Shifter is really notchy now, started being locked out of 1-2 shift last night, and now the car will not go into reverse, at all. At low rpm, or sitting motionless, it shifts just fine, but when I get on it, I'm locked out. I'll fill in the survey and report to dealer. Very disappointing. The new Shelby's have Tremec's in them, and I'm starting to wonder why?
